The Master of Science in Civil and Environmental Engineering (Hydrology and Fluid Dynamics track) at Duke University offers an interdisciplinary curriculum with flexible coursework options tailored to individual research interests, emphasizing modern environmental fluid dynamics, hydrology, and water resources challenges.

Courses include: Applied Mathematics for Engineers Engineering Data Analysis Scientific Computing Mathematical Modeling Intermediate Fluid Mechanics Advanced Fluid Mechanics Environmental Fluid Mechanics Physical Hydrology and Hydrometeorology Ecohydrology Vegetation and Hydrology Biogeochemistry Pollutant Transport Systems Vadose Zone Hydrology Groundwater Hydrology and Contaminant Transport
Applicants must hold a bachelor's degree in engineering or science from an accredited institution, with transcripts including GPA and grading scale. Submission of a Statement of Purpose, Resume, three recommendations, GRE scores (or equivalent), and official English language test results (TOEFL or IELTS) are required. An interview or video introduction may be requested. The application fee is US$75, payable via credit card or check made to Duke University.
